Abstract | A growing number of charter schools are serving rural communities. More than 320,000 students are enrolled in rural charter schools across the United States. Due to a smaller population and geographic isolation, charter schools in rural areas face many challenges. The autonomy and flexibility of the charter school model can help mitigate some of the challenges and offer a lifeline to strengthen small communities. The full report dives into the current landscape of charter schools, challenges and opportunities, and the overall impact of charter schools in rural communities. (As Provided). |
